Recipe - Dilly Cheese Cubes

Ingredients:

8 ounce Loaf French Bread
One half cup Butter
1 pound Cheddar Cheese; Shredded
2 teaspoon Dried Dill Weed
1 teaspoon Worcestershire Sauce
1 tablespoon Grated Onion
2 Eggs; Slightly Beaten

Remove crust from bread; reserve crusts for another purpose. Cut bread into
40 1" cubes; set aside. Add butter and cheese to a medium saucepan over low
heat. Cook, stirring, until melted. Stir in dill weed, worcestershire sauce
and onion. Remove from heat and cool slightly. Use a whisk or electric
mixer to beat in eggs. Using a fork, dip each bread cube into hot cheese
mixture, turning to coat all sides. Shake off excess sauce. Arrange coated
cubes on an ungreased baking sheet. Refrigerate 1 to 2 days or freeze
immediately. Store frozen cubes in airtight containers up to 6 months. To
serve, preheat oven to 350. Bake refrigerated cubes 10 minutes or frozen
cubes 15 minutes. Serve hot.

Recipe by: Appetizers and Small Meals by Mable Hoffman

Dilly Cheese Cubes recipe makes 4 Servings
